    i saw a short on You Tube of the Hearns-Medal fight and it struck me , the similarities between these two fights!

    In both cases, the challenger was Puerto Rican
    In both cases the challenger was looking for his second world crown
    In both cases, the challenger was a world champion
    In both cases, all boxers were hard hitting powerhouses
    In both cases, WBC titles were at stake
    In both cases, the fight was at the Caesar's Palace hotel in Las Vegas
    In both cases, the champions ended up in the international boxing hall of fame
    In both cases, the champion was involved, directly or indirectly in tragic vehicular crashes. Sanchez died in 1982, while Hearns' rival James Shuler, died 11 days after their 1986 fight
    In both cases, the challenger went down in round one but got up and put up an excellent, courageous show trying to turn the fight around
    In both cases, the challenger suffered hideous eye injuries and had their eyes closed towards the end
    In both cases, the fight ended in round eight by technical knockout

    Are these the two most similar boxing fights in the history of the sport????
